A City Built on Design, Architecture, and Creative Confidence
Columbus has one of the strongest design identities in the Midwest, and it shows up everywhere from architecture to public spaces to retail. Modern buildings sit comfortably next to historic neighborhoods, creating a visual rhythm that feels thoughtful rather than chaotic. The city has invested deeply in public art and urban planning, which gives even everyday neighborhoods a sense of intention. Walking through areas like the Short North or German Village feels curated but lived-in, the kind of balance that is hard to fake. The presence of world-class design institutions has shaped the city’s visual language, and it shows in subtle ways that seasoned travelers notice right away.
Food That Rivals Bigger Cities Without the Attitude
Columbus has quietly become one of the most interesting food cities in the country, driven by chefs who care more about quality than hype. The dining scene feels confident and personal, with restaurants that prioritize craft over spectacle. Steakhouses in particular have become a calling card, offering refined spaces and serious menus without leaning into stuffiness. A standout Columbus steakhouse experience is less about theatrics and more about precision, excellent sourcing, and service that knows when to step in and when to step back. The city’s broader food culture reflects its diversity, with global influences shaping menus across every neighborhood, making it easy to eat exceptionally well without ever feeling rushed or crowded.
